Chemical Properties of Isopropyldecalin (CAS 27193-29-9)

Isopropyldecalin

InChI
InChI=1S/C13H24/c1-10(2)12-9-5-7-11-6-3-4-8-13(11)12/h10-13H,3-9H2,1-2H3
InChI Key
VIJJVIFWVZYBLO-UHFFFAOYSA-N
Formula
C13H24
SMILES
CC(C)C1CCCC2CCCCC21
Molecular Weight1
180.33
CAS
27193-29-9
Other Names
  • Decahydro(1-methylethyl)naphthalene
